Sarfarosh is a gripping action-drama film released in the year 1999. It was directed by John Matthew Matthan and produced by Dharmendra. The film stars Aamir Khan, Naseeruddin Shah, Sonali Bendre in lead roles, while Mukesh Rishi, Akhilendra Mishra, Pradeep Rawat, and others play supporting roles. The film follows the journey of an honest, patriotic Indian police officer who is on a harrowing mission to uncover a terror conspiracy inside the country.

The story is set in Mumbai, where Aamir Khan plays the role of Ajay Singh Rathod, a valiant police officer. Rathod is deeply patriotic and is committed to his work. He leads an undercover operation to trap smugglers who have been illegally bringing arms into the country. In the process, he uncovers a bigger conspiracy, which involves terrorist groups and powerful people who are determined to destroy the country.

Naseeruddin Shah plays the role of Ghazi Baba, the mastermind behind the terror network. The character of Ghazi Baba is one of the finest performances by Naseeruddin Shah. He is calm, composed, and intelligent, with a strategic mind. His primary aim is to which to spread terror and divide the country. The character is so impactful that it still remains fresh in the minds of the audience, even after two decades.

Sonali Bendre's character, Jyoti, is an integral part of the story. She is a doctor who becomes Rathod's love interest, and her character brings a much-needed emotional element to the story. Jyoti's character is also a symbol of hope, who at every moment supports Rathod in his mission to eradicate the threat to the country.

Sarfarosh is a perfect example of a patriotic movie, which balances action with the essence of immersing oneself in the love of their country. The film showcases a series of thrilling incidents, brilliantly executed by the director, John Mathew Matthan. He has done an outstanding job of capturing the essence of Indian culture, tradition, and patriotism, and beautifully blends it into the storyline at every crucial point.

The background score of the film, which was composed by the well-known duo, Jatin-Lalit, successfully heightens the tension at every crucial moment. The songs, such as 'Hosh Walon Ko Khabar Kya' and 'Jo Haal Dil Ka', which were penned by Nida Fazli, became immensely popular after the release of the movie.

The film's technical aspects are also noteworthy. The cinematography by Vikas Sivaraman captures the essence of Mumbai city and adds a realistic touch to the overall look of the film. The editing by Jethu Mundul is sharp, and the pacing of the movie is perfect, keeping the audience engrossed till the end.

The film's climax is intense and satisfying, showcasing the heroism of Rathod and his team. Sarfarosh is a fine example of a movie that can create a significant impact on its viewers. It instills a sense of patriotism and love for one's country, and also reflects the importance of the job that the police force does.

Overall, Sarfarosh is a must-watch movie for anyone who loves action-drama, patriotic films. It is considered to be one of Aamir Khan's best performances and is considered a classic in Indian cinema. The movie is a perfect example of the strong writing, captivating performances, and technical excellence coming together beautifully to create cinema at its finest.
